#2cd708 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#2cd708 is composed of 17.3% red, 84.3% green and 3.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 79.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 96.3% yellow and 15.7% black. It has a hue angle of 109.6 degrees, a saturation of 92.8% and a lightness of 43.7%. #2cd708 color hex could be obtained by blending #58ff10 with #00af00. Closest websafe color is: #33cc00.

#2cd708 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#2cd708 has RGB values of R:44, G:215, B:8 and CMYK values of C:0.8, M:0, Y:0.96, K:0.16. Its decimal value is 2938632.

Shades and Tints of #2cd708
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010700 is the darkest color, while #f5fff3 is the lightest one.
